RESPONSIBILITY AND SPAN OF AUTHORITY:
1. COMMUNICATIONS
Manage the incoming communications M+M, including telephone & voice mail. Distribute messages to
the appropriate managers and staff ensuring timely and proper follow up.
Communicate information to appropriate culinary team members in a prompt fashion to allow the
team members to respond as necessary to guest requests/preferences and work together as a team.
Oversee messages taking process and make sure that all messages are directed to the appropriate
managers.
Ensure that only M+M approved templates are being used for incoming and outgoing messages.
Staying consistent with proper, professional etiquette & language. No use of "slang" words.
2. ADMINISTRATION
Process gift cards requests for M+M
Proper distribution of all pre-pays as noted in reservations
Log, track and oversee the return of all lost property left at M+M
Log and code all special event attendees
Maintain guests databases and mailing lists via Open Table
Distribution of all guest information to proper team members including Management, Captains & Chef
3. RESERVATION MANAGEMENT
At the direction of AGM and Maître D
Assist in communicating all in house notes regarding guests, including special occasions, special needs
and allergies/dietary preferences
Manage the bookings in OpenTable, ensuring maximum reservations while following protocols
outlined in the reservations manual.
Manage confirmation schedule
Alert management to VIP reservations as they are made
4. GUEST SERVICES
Daily input of guest notes, last visits and area code location
Receiving, seating, and bidding of farewell to guests
